Linux系统下解析BTMP日志秘诀
linux btmp log

作者:IIS7AI 时间:2025-01-13 11:06



Linux Btmp Log:深入解析与安全应用 在Linux系统中,日志文件是系统管理员和安全专家不可或缺的宝贵资源

    它们记录了系统运行的点点滴滴,从用户登录到系统错误,无一不记录在案

    在众多日志文件中,btmp(Bad login attempts log)日志扮演着至关重要的角色,它专门记录失败的登录尝试,是监控和防御潜在安全威胁的重要工具

    本文将深入探讨Linux btmp日志的结构、读取方法、重要性以及在实际安全应用中的具体策略,旨在帮助读者充分理解和有效利用这一关键资源

     一、btmp日志概述 btmp日志是Linux系统中专门用于记录失败登录尝试的日志文件

    与记录所有登录活动(无论成功与否)的wtmp日志不同,btmp专注于那些未能成功验证的登录尝试

    这意味着,每当有用户尝试通过SSH、终端或其他方式登录系统但未能通过身份验证时,相关信息就会被记录到btmp日志中

     btmp日志通常位于`/var/log/btmp`路径下,但这一位置可能因Linux发行版的不同而有所变化

    值得注意的是,由于安全考虑,btmp文件通常不是以文本形式存储的,而是采用二进制格式,这增加了直接阅读其内容的难度,但同时也增强了数据的安全性和完整性

     二、读取btmp日志 虽然btmp日志以二进制形式存储,但Linux提供了多种工具来解析和查看其内容

    最常用的工具之一是`lastb`命令,它能够从btmp日志中提取并显示失败的登录尝试信息

     使用`lastb`命令的基本语法如下: lastb【选项】 例如,运行`lastb`而不带任何选项将列出所有失败的登录尝试,包括登录时间、源IP地址(如果可用)、用户名以及登录失败的原因

     通过添加特定的选项,用户可以进一步定制`lastb`的输出

    例如,使用`-i`选项可以忽略IP地址的反向解析,加快查询速度;`-f`选项允许指定要查看的btmp文件路径,这对于在不同路径下存储btmp日志的系统特别有用

     除了`lastb`,还有其他工具如`btmpdump`也能解析btmp日志,提供了更丰富的输出格式和更强大的过滤功能,适合需要深入分析日志的高级用户

     三、btmp日志的重要性 btmp日志的重要性体现在多个方面: 1.安全监控:通过监控btmp日志,系统管理员可以及时发现并响应可疑的登录尝试,如来自未知IP地址的频繁失败登录,这可能是暴力破解攻击的前兆

     2.入侵检测:结合其他安全日志(如auth.log、secure.log等),btmp日志能够为入侵检测系统(IDS)提供宝贵的数据输入,帮助识别并阻止潜在的恶意活动

     3.合规性审计:在许多行业,如金融、医疗和政府,遵守数据保护和隐私法规是强制性的

    btmp日志记录了所有失败的访问尝试,有助于证明组织已采取适当措施保护其系统免受未经授权的访问

     4.性能优化:通过分析失败的登录尝试,管理员可以识别并禁用无效的用户账户,减少系统资源的浪费,同时提高系统的整体安全性

     四、安全应用策略 为了充分发挥btmp日志在安全领域的潜力,以下是一些实用的应用策略: 1.定期审查:建立定期审查btmp日志的机制,如每日或每周一次,以便及时发现并响应异常活动

     2.设置警报:利用脚本或第三方工具(如Snort、OSSEC)监控btmp日志,当检测到特定模式的失败登录尝试时触发警报,如短时间内多次尝试同一用户名或来自同一IP地址的失败登录

     3.IP黑名单:对于频繁尝试非法登录的IP地址,可以考虑将其添加到防火墙规则中,暂时或永久阻止其访问

     4.增强身份验证:根据btmp日志的分析结果,考虑实施更严格的身份验证措施,如双因素认证(2FA)、密码策略强化等

     5.日志轮换与归档:鉴于btmp日志可能随时间增长而变得庞大,实施日志轮换策略,定期归档旧日志,同时确保新日志的连续记录

     6.教育与培训:对用户进行安全意识培训,强调强密码的重要性,以及避免在公共网络上进行敏感操作,减少因用户疏忽导致的安全事件

     五、结论 Linux btmp日志作为记录失败登录尝试的关键日志类型,是系统安全监控和防御体系中的重要组成部分

    通过有效管理和分析btmp日志,系统管理员能够及时发现潜在的安全威胁,采取必要的预防措施,保护系统免受未经授权的访问和数据泄露

    本文介绍了btmp日志的基本概念、读取方法、重要性以及在实际安全应用中的策略,旨在为Linux系统管理员提供一份实用的指南,助力构建更加坚固的安全防线

    随着网络威胁的不断演变,持续关注并优化日志管理策略,将是维护系统安全的关键所在